本文详细试验了碘量法测定铁矿石、还原及焙烧铁矿产物中金属铁和全铁的条件,并应用于生产、从而使测定金属铁和全铁的方法统一起来,既不使用汞盐,又为工作带来方便。试验共分三个部分:(1)碘量法测定铁的基本条件;(2)金属铁的测定;(3)全铁的测定。 (1)碘量法测定铁的基本条件: 2Fe~(2+)+(?)2Fe~(2+)I_2从反应式可知,可用硫代硫酸钠标准溶液滴定碘来间接测定铁,实验确定了下述适宜条件;介质为0.3—2.0N盐酸,选用0.7N;温度50—60℃;碘化钾用量1—3克,选用2克;加入碘化钾析出
This paper examines in detail the determination of iron ores by iodometric methods, the reduction and roasting of iron and iron products in iron and iron conditions, and applied to the production, so that the determination of metal iron and total iron methods unify, neither the use of mercury salts , But also bring convenience to work. The test is divided into three parts: (1) iodometric method for the determination of iron basic conditions; (2) determination of metallic iron; (3) determination of total iron. (1) The basic conditions for the determination of iron by iodometric method: 2Fe ~ (2 +) + (?) 2Fe ~ (2 +) I_2 It can be known from the reaction formula that iron can be titrated with sodium thiosulfate standard solution to determine iron indirectly. The following suitable conditions; medium is 0.3-2.0N hydrochloric acid, the choice of 0.7N; temperature 50-60 ℃; potassium iodide dosage of 1-3 grams, choose 2 grams; precipitation was added potassium iodide
